What is Cryptocurrency?

The necessity for a decentralised currency system to liberate the “masses” from the tight control of central banks and other financial institutions was evident when the Bitcoin whitepaper first appeared. When bitcoin was created, it replaced fiat as the currency of governments and became the currency of the people. After over ten years, Bitcoin has gained enormous global appeal and inspired the creation of over 1,500 more alternative blockchain-based currencies.

Any kind of money that exists digitally or virtually and uses cryptography to safeguard transactions is known as cryptocurrency, also referred to as crypto-currency or crypto. Cryptocurrencies use a decentralised mechanism to track transactions and create new units rather than a central body to issue or regulate them.

How does cryptocurrency work?

Blockchain, a distributed public ledger that is updated and maintained by currency holders, is the technology that underlies cryptocurrencies.

By leveraging computer processing power to solve challenging mathematical puzzles, a process known as “mining,” units of cryptocurrency are created. Additionally, customers can purchase the currencies from brokers and then store and use those using digital wallets.

You don’t actually own anything if you hold cryptocurrencies. What you possess is a key that enables you to transfer a record or a unit of measurement from one person to another without the help of an established intermediary.

Despite Bitcoin has been in existence since 2009, cryptocurrencies and blockchain technology applications are still emerging in financial terms, with additional applications expected in the future. The technology could someday be used to trade bonds, equities, and other financial assets.

Types of cryptocurrencies
Numerous cryptocurrencies are present. Among the most well-known are:

• Bitcoin:

The original cryptocurrency and still the most traded, Bitcoin was established in 2009. The person or group, whose specific identity is still unknown, usually regarded as the pseudonym Satoshi Nakamoto, is credited with creating the money.

• Ethereum:

Ethereum, a blockchain platform created in 2015, has its own digital currency called Ether (ETH), also known as Ethereum. After Bitcoin, it is the most widely used cryptocurrency.

• Litecoin:

Despite moving more quickly to develop new ideas, such as speedier payments and processes to allow more transactions, this money is most comparable to bitcoin.

• Ripple:

A distributed ledger system called Ripple was created in 2012. Ripple is a tool that can be used to track more than just cryptocurrency transactions. The organisation that created it has collaborated with numerous banks and financial organisations. The term “altcoins” is used to distinguish non-Bitcoin cryptocurrencies from the original.

How to purchase cryptocurrencies

You might be thinking about secure cryptocurrency purchases. Typically, there are three steps.

• Deciding on a platform

Selecting the platform is the first step. Typically, you have two options: a standard broker or a specific bitcoin exchange:

Standard brokers. These are online brokers that give customers the option to purchase and sell cryptocurrencies as well as traditional financial instruments, including equities, bonds, and exchange-traded funds (ETFs). Although they often have fewer crypto capabilities, some platforms have reduced trading costs.

Exchanges for cryptocurrencies. There are numerous cryptocurrency exchanges to pick from, and they all provide access to a variety of digital assets, wallet storage, interest-bearing account alternatives, and other features. Asset-based fees are common on exchanges.

• Investing in your account

The next step is to fund your account, so you can start trading after selecting your trading platform. Although it differs by platform, the majority of cryptocurrency exchanges let users buy cryptocurrency with fiat (i.e., government-issued) currencies like the US Dollar, the British Pound, or the Euro using their debit or credit cards.
Credit card purchases of cryptocurrencies are frowned upon, and some exchanges do not support them. Several credit card companies also forbid cryptocurrency transactions. This is due to the fact that cryptocurrencies are quite erratic, making it unwise to risk incurring debt or paying hefty credit card transaction fees for some assets.
Fees are an essential consideration. These include possible transaction fees for deposits and withdrawals as well as trading costs. Fees will differ by payment method and platform, so do your research upfront.

• Making a purchase

You can place an order using the web or mobile platforms of your broker or exchange. You can purchase cryptocurrencies by clicking “buy,” selecting the order type, entering the quantity, and then completing the order if you intend to do so. A similar method is used for “sell” orders.

Metatrader: What Is It?

For trading a variety of assets, traders often use the MetaTrader platform. It serves as your entry point to the trading marketplaces. It is a feature-rich platform that enables traders to carry out a variety of trading tasks, including charting and technical analysis, market monitoring, and trade automation using expert advisors. Let’s have a closer look at the MetaTrader. Trading software called MetaTrader is particularly well-liked among traders. It is provided by the majority of reputable brokers, including AvaTrade, and is regarded as the platform of choice. Let’s examine the MetaTrader platform in more detail.

The MetaTrader Platform is now offered in two versions:

MetaTrader 4 and MetaTrader 5

The most widely used trading platform in the world, MetaTrader 4 (MT4), provides everything you need for online trading on a single interface. A potent combination of cutting-edge trading tools and analytical technology are available on a single platform, enabling users to apply even the most intricate technical trading methods.

The most recent version of the well-known MetaTrader platform is called MetaTrader 5 (MT5). Although the MT5 is more recent, it is not always an improved version.

Even though it is marketed as being significantly more advanced than its predecessor, MetaTrader 4, the more recent version 5, is not all that different from it. The MT5 is faster at execution, has more sophisticated charting systems, and has deeper analytical features. You can even trade cryptocurrencies on MT5. Although the MT4 is regarded as a top platform for forex traders, you might choose the MT5 if any of the aforementioned features appeal to you more. However, MT4 continues to be the platform that is downloaded and used the most.

Whichever platform you select, you won’t notice any lag in your computer’s speed. Fast trading and speedy execution are made possible by the software’s small weight, which won’t overburden your systems. These are crucial aspects to take into account when trading in quick-moving and occasionally volatile markets.
